Saddlebags are reproduced and available through V-Twin Mfg. The "Yellow" book, page 721.
They have been modified, all extra brackets removed, holes filled, entire surface glazed, sanded smooth and painted, wet sanded and buffed.
The Tour Pak is NOS factory original. It currently is in the body shop getting the same treatment as the saddlebags got.

Tour Pak is all done. When the body shop sanded it down, they found that the "orange peel" surface was in fact a thin outer gel coating covering raw fiberglass! So after sanding it smooth, they had to spray it with a thick coat of "Feather Fill", then block it smooth, then paint, wet sand and finally buff. ALOT of work, but it is like glass now.
